The SPI80N08S2-07R belongs to the category of power MOSFETs.
It is used as a switching device in various electronic circuits, particularly in power supply and motor control applications.
The SPI80N08S2-07R is typically available in a TO-220 package.
This MOSFET is essential for efficient power management and control in electronic systems.
It is commonly packaged in reels or tubes and is available in varying quantities based on customer requirements.
The SPI80N08S2-07R typically has three pins: 1. Gate (G) 2. Drain (D) 3. Source (S)
The SPI80N08S2-07R operates based on the principles of field-effect transistors, where the voltage applied to the gate terminal controls the flow of current between the drain and source terminals.
The SPI80N08S2-07R is widely used in: - Power supplies - Motor control systems - Inverters - DC-DC converters - Battery management systems
